WeAct Studio STM32U585CIU6 Core Mini board

WeAct STM32U585CIU6 Core Mini – An $8 STM32U5 board supported by MicroPython v1.28

While checking out MicroPython v1.28 changelog, I noticed a board from WeAct Studio based on ST’s STM32U5 Cortex-M33 microcontroller: the WeAct STM32U585CIU6 Mini Core board (WEACTSTUDIO_MINI_STM32U585 in MicroPython code). I found it interesting/newsworthy, as while I had written about the initial STM32U5 MCU release in 2021, and followed up with beefier STM32U5 SKUs with NeoChrom 2.5D GPU and up to 4MB flash in 2023, we had yet to cover a third-party board based on an STM32U5 MCU, excluding the Arduino UNO Q SBC running Linux on a Qualcomm QRB2210 MPU and using an STM32U585 for real-time and I/O control. The WeAct STM32U585CIU6 Core Mini changes that as a low-cost, standalone STM32U5 MCU board. WeAct STM32U585CIU6 Core Mini specifications: Microcontroller – ST STM32U585CIU6 Core – Arm Cortex-M33 Armv8-M core clocked at up to 160 MHz with FPU, Arm TrustZone Memory – 768 KB RAM Flash – 2048 KB flash GPU – […]

STM32C5 Series

STMicro STM32C5 entry-level, 144 MHz Cortex-M33 MCU features up to 1MB flash, 256KB SRAM, Ethernet, CAN Bus

Not to be confused with the just-released STM32U3B5/C5 ultra-low-power MCUs, the entry-level STM32C5 Arm Cortex-M33 MCU family is designed for industrial sensors, smart home devices, electronic locks, thermostats, wearables, robotic actuators, and computer peripherals. The MCUs are manufactured using ST’s 40 nm flash process, clocked at up to 144 MHz, and feature 128 KB to 1 MB of flash and up to 256 KB of SRAM, with a dynamic power consumption of <80 µA/MHz. Key features include Ethernet, USB, OctoSPI, CAN bus, DMA, and various peripherals, including ADCs, comparators, and an op-amp. Security is also enhanced, with the series targeting SESIP3 and PSA Certified Level 3 through features such as side-channel attack-resistant crypto, Hardware Unique Keys (HUK), and a Coupling and Chaining Bridge (CCB) for secure key storage. STM32C5 key features and specifications: MCU core Arm Cortex-M33 32-bit CPU @ 144 MHz with single-precision FPU, DSP instructions, and MPU Performance […]


STM32U3B5 STM32U3C5 block diagram

STM32U3B5/C5 ultra-low-power MCU features 640 KB RAM, 2 MB Flash, and HSP accelerator to run AI without batteries

STMicroelectronics has added two members to the STM32U3 ultra-low-power Arm Cortex-M33 microcontroller family: the STM32U3B5 and STM32U3C5 MCUs get more resources with up to 640 KB SRAM and 2 MB flash, as well as an HSP (hardware signal processor) accelerator to run AI/ML workloads without batteries, just using energy harvesting. The new chips are still clocked at up to 96 MHz, benefit from a near-threshold design (down to 0.65 V), allowing a power consumption of just 117 Coremark/mW in active mode, and can operate up to 105°C ambient temperature. They come with one additional group of interfaces, bringing the total to four SPI and I2C, two I3C and CAN-FD, and five UARTs, as well as five more 16-bit timers, for a total of 10. The STM32U3C5 also includes a cryptocore to accelerate encryption and decryption operations, and supports the CCB (Coupling and Chaining Bridge) hardware security feature, both of which […]

Semtech LR2021 LoRa Development Board

LR2021 LoRa Plus board combines Semtech LR2021 and Nordic nRF54L15 for high-speed FLRC and LoRa connectivity

Last year, Semtech released the LR2021 LoRa Plus transceiver chip, designed to address the low data-rate issue associated with LoRa, but surprisingly, they didn’t release a development board for the chip. Now, almost a year later, Seeed Studio and Semtech have partnered to introduce the LR2021 LoRa Plus development kit targeting long-range high-speed LoRa and FLRC applications up to 2.6 Mbps. Not only does the board support LoRa Gen 4 technology, providing Sub-GHz, 2.4 GHz ISM, and S/L-band operation, but a XIAO nRF54L15 board also adds dual-core processing (Arm Cortex-M33 + RISC-V) and supports other short-range protocols, including NFC, Bluetooth LE 6.0, Matter, Thread, and 2.4 GHz proprietary protocols. The development board also features a 0.96-inch 128×64 OLED, three Grove connectors for expansion, a USB Type-C for power, SWD debugging, and two Sub-GHz and 2.4 GHz SMA connectors. It is compatible with Arduino Uno, STM32 Nucleo, and Nordic DK boards. […]

MicroPython v1.27

MicroPython v1.27 adds support for ESP32-C5, ESP32-P4, and STM32U5 microcontrollers

MicroPython is one of the most popular firmware for microcontrollers due to its ease of use. The MicroPython v1.27 release adds support for some interesting microcontrollers, namely Espressif Systems ESP32-C5 and ESP32-P4, thanks to an update to the ESP-IDF v5.5.1 framework, as well as STMicroelectronics STM32U5, and features a range of other changes. These include improvements to the test suite to cater to the increasing number of supported hardware platforms, the introduction of tier levels for different hardware platforms, various optimizations and bug fixes, updated libraries, new ESP32 and STM32 boards, and more. The last time we reported on a MicroPython release was for v1.24, which added support for Raspberry Pi RP2350 and ESP32-C6 microcontrollers.   Other MicroPython v1.27 highlights: Test suite improvements Auto-detecting if the target has Unicode support Automatically including float tests when possible Always including stress tests Improving the skipping of tests that use slice and the […]

STM32V8 STM32V863 873 block diagram

ST launches 800 MHz STM32V8 Arm Cortex-M85 high-performance MCU manufactured with 18nm FD-SOI process

ST has just launched its most powerful STM32 microcontroller so far, with the STM32V8 family, the first equipped with a Cortex-M85 core (clocked at up to 800 MHz) and manufactured with an 18nm FD-SOI process. It’s a non-pin compatible update to the STM32H7 family that delivers up to 5,072 CoreMarks, greatly improves Edge AI performance thanks to Arm Helium and MVE, integrates up to 4MB eNVM (Embedded NVM), operates up to 140°C, and adds PCM (phase-change memory) radiation immunity. Two main parts have been launched in different configurations and packages: STM32V863 and STM32V873. STM32V863/873 specifications: Core – 32-bit Arm Cortex-M85 CPU @ up to 800MHz with Arm Helium, Arm MVE, TrustZone…; up to 5,072 CoreMarks Multimedia accelerators – Chrom-ART 2D GPU, and JPEG hardware accelerator Memory/Storage 1.5 MB system SRAM with ECC (partial) 8 KB backup RAM 192 KB zero-wait state TCM Up to 512 KB TCM with ECC Up […]

Advertisement


STM32WBA6 block diagram

STMicro STM32WBA6 2.4 GHz wireless MCU gets up to 2MB flash, 512KB SRAM, USB OTG, and more

STMicro had two announcements yesterday. I’ve already covered the launch of the ultra-low-power STM32U3 microcontroller family, so today, I’ll check the new 100 MHz STM32WBA6 Cortex-M33 wireless MCU family with 2.4GHz radios for Bluetooth LE 6.0, Zigbee, Thread, and Matter designed for wearables, smart home devices, remote weather sensors, and more. The STM32WBA6 is an evolution of the STM32WBA family introduced last year, especially of the STM32WBA54 and STM32WBA55 with many of the same features SESIP (Security Evaluation Standard for IoT Platforms) Level 3 security certification, but gets more memory and flash with up to 512KB of SRAM and up to 2MB of flash. The new  STM32WBA6 family also gains a High-Speed USB OTG interface and extra digital interfaces such as three SPI ports, four I2C ports, three USARTs, and one LPUART. STMicro STM32WBA6 key features and specifications: MCU core – Arm Cortex-M33 at 100MHz with FPU and DSP Memory […]

STM32U3 block diagram

STMicro STM32U3 ultra-low-power Cortex-M33 MCU achieves 117 Coremark/mW in active mode, consumes 1.6 µA in stop mode

STMicro STM32U3 is a new family of Arm Cortex-M33 microcontrollers clocked at up to 96 MHz with ultra-low-power consumption designed for utility meters, healthcare devices such as glucose meters and insulin pumps, and industrial sensors. The company says the STM32U3 MCU family is a “market leader in terms of efficiency” with 117 Coremark/mW in active mode, and consumes 1.6µA in stop mode. The Coremark/mW score means the STM32U3 offers almost twice the efficiency of the STM32U5 series, and five times that of the STM32L4 series. Other highlights include up to 1MB of dual-bank flash, 256kB of SRAM, and various interfaces like MIPI I3C, SAI audio, 12-bit ADC, etc… STMicro STM32U3 key features and specifications: MCU Core 32-bit Arm Cortex-M33 CPU @ 96 MHz with TrustZone and FPU Performance 1.5 DMIPS/MHz (Dhrystone 2.1) 387 CoreMark (4.09 CoreMark/MHz) 500 ULPMark-CP 117 ULPMark-CM 202000 SecureMark-TLS ART Accelerator with DSP instructions Memory/Storage 256 KB […]

Boardcon MINI1126B-P AI vision system-on-module wit Rockchip RV1126B-P SoC